Summary of Business Details by State
Understanding the corporation information for every state is vital for business owners and businesses looking to set up their presence in the U.S.. technology company directory has its distinct regulations, requirements, and tools available for businesses, which can greatly influence the decision of where to register. From Alabama to Wyoming, the existence of commercial directory services aids individuals navigate these challenges smoothly.
Every state provides a variety of data regarding business formation, which includes submission fees, necessary documentation, and yearly reporting obligations. For example, Delaware is often a preferred state for incorporation due to its business-friendly laws and financial advantages. In contrast, states like California and New York offer robust markets but may present higher administrative hurdles and costs.
Moreover, using online directories simplifies the procedure of accessing business information across states. Entrepreneurs can rapidly locate essential details about running their company in multiple jurisdictions, making sure they remain within the law while making knowledgeable decisions. As companies increasingly transition to the internet, the role of these resources becomes essential in promoting transparency and availability to valuable business resources.

Influence of Technology on Corporate Data Access
The emergence of tech has fundamentally changed how businesses and individuals obtain corporation data across multiple regions. Online databases now serve as comprehensive resources that provide detailed data on companies, which makes it easier than ever to acquire data. In states like California and Texas, individuals can rapidly look up for corporate details such as formation dates, agents of record, and business status through easy-to-navigate interfaces. This accessibility not only enhances the research process but also allows users to make educated choices about prospective partnerships and investments.
Furthermore, technology has enhanced the reliability of the corporate data found in digital directories. With immediate refreshes and mechanized information collection, government authorities guarantee that the information is current and reliable. For instance, in regions like Florida and NY, businesses can depend on online systems that consistently synchronize with official administrative records, reducing the risk of obsolete or mistaken data. This instant availability to accurate data is essential for entrepreneurs looking to comply with legal requirements and for clients seeking trustworthy companies.

Difficulties in Administering Online Enterprise Listings
Overseeing online company listings presents many challenges for entrepreneurs and businesses alike. One major issue is making sure the correctness of the information provided. With various platforms available, data discrepancies can arise, resulting in confusion among clients. Incorrect listings may include wrong company names, addresses, or phone numbers, which can hinder customer access and impact a company's reputation. Maintaining continuity across all directories is vital yet often demanding, especially for businesses running in multiple states such as Alaska.
Another obstacle is dealing with the myriad of directories and platforms where enterprises can be listed. Each platform has its own standards, guidelines, and best practices, which makes it complicated for owners to maneuver successfully. For instance, the specific data needed for company information may vary significantly between states, making the process even more complex for organizations seeking extensive visibility from Alaska to California. This difficulty can lead to missed opportunities to engage with possible customers and increase traffic.
Finally, the ever-changing nature of online directories necessitates constant vigilance and updates. Companies must routinely check their listings for changes that could affect their visibility and search rankings. Rivals may also be adjusting their strategies, prompting businesses to keep pace with changing trends and customer preferences. This persistent need for attention can be time-consuming and take away entrepreneurs from focusing on core business activities, which is especially problematic for lesser enterprises with constrained resources.
